Hmm. Only other thing I can think of is if you have an always on VPN on the phone and Orbot is routing the Tor connection through it to explain the behavior.
Either way, a bridge on the computer should mask the use of Tor and hopefully allow it to connect. Its what bridges were designed for.
I’m not sure what the Tor Project advice is these days, but my phone is setup to have Netguard hijack the VPN option of AOS and force select apps over tor (to Orbot). It’s annoying because in fact it is impossible for me to run Netguard and Tor over a VPN. Because Netguard hijacks the VPN, I cannot use a real VPN. I can run a VPN (generally openVPN), but then I must give up Tor if I do that. Orbot can only run in parallel, but because Netguard loses the VPN slot I can only use Tor-aware apps in that situation. So ultimately what you’re thinking is not possible with my tool chain (of old versions).
